
Cost of Fire Restoration Service in West Palm Beach
Fire restoration services in West Palm Beach, FL can be a significant expense, but they are crucial for ensuring your property is safe and habitable after a fire. Understanding the various factors that influence the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ively for these services.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Fire Damage: The severity of the fire and the extent of the damage it caused.
- Size of the Property: Larger properties typically incur higher restoration costs.
- Type of Materials Affected: Different materials require different restoration techniques and costs.
- Water Damage: Often, water used to extinguish the fire causes additional damage.
- Soot and Smoke Removal: The level of soot and smoke damage that needs to be cleaned.
- Structural Repairs: The necessity for structural repairs to the building.
- Emergency Services: Costs can increase if emergency services are required immediately after the fire.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in West Palm Beach, FL.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(West Palm Beach, FL) |
---|---|
Initial Assessment | $200 - $500 |
Water Extraction |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Soot and Smoke Removal |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Structural Repairs | $3,000 - $15,000 |
Odor Removal | $200 - $1,000 |
Full Restoration | $10,000 - $50,000 |
